首页
首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
JVM
爱吃芝士的土豆倪
创建于2024-01-21
订阅专栏
以实战的方式介绍jvm
等 9 人订阅
共9篇文章
创建于2024-01-21
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
JVM系列-9.性能调优
性能调优 性能优化的步骤总共分为四个步骤,其中修复部分要具体问题具体分析且处理方式各不相同。 性能调优解决的问题 应用程序在运行过程中经常会出现性能问题,比较常见的性能问题现象是: 1、通过top命令
JVM系列-8.GC调优
GC调优 GC调优指的是对**垃圾回收(Garbage Collection)**进行调优。GC调优的主要目标是避免由垃圾回收引起程序性能下降。 GC调优的核心分成三部分: 1、通用Jvm参数的设置。
JVM系列-7内存调优
内存调优 内存泄漏和内存溢出 内存泄漏(memory leak):在Java中如果不再使用一个对象,但是该对象依然在GC ROOT的引用链上,这个对象就不会被垃圾回收器回收,这种情况就称之为内存泄漏。
JVM系列-6.java垃圾回收
垃圾回收 在C/C++这类没有自动垃圾回收机制的语言中,一个对象如果不再使用,需要手动释放,否则就会出现内存泄漏。我们称这种释放对象的过程为垃圾回收,而需要程序员编写代码进行回收的方式为手动回收。 内
JVM系列-5.java内存区域
Java内存区域 Java虚拟机在运行Java程序过程中管理的内存区域,称之为运行时数据区。 《Java虚拟机规范》中规定了每一部分的作用。 运行时数据区 – 应用场景 通过上面的问题,可以知道jav
JVM系列-4.类加载器
类加载器 类加载器(ClassLoader)是Java虚拟机提供给应用程序去实现获取类和接口字节码数据的技术。 类加载器只参与加载过程中的字节码获取并加载到内存这一部分。 类加载器的分类 类加载器分为
JVM系列-3.类的生命周期
类的生命周期 类的生命周期描述了一个类加载、使用、卸载的整个过程 生命周期概述 类的卸载会在垃圾回收篇讲解 如果比较细致的区分,会分成七个阶段。 加载阶段 1.加载(Loading)阶段第一步是类加载
JVM系列-2.字节码文件详解
字节码文件详解 JVM的组成 字节码文件的组成 学习字节码文件有什么用呢? 能够从字节指令的角度去回答疑难杂症的面试题。 其他的应用场景呢? 以正确的姿势打开文件 字节码文件中保存了源代码编译之后的内
JVM系列-1.初识JVM
初识JVM 什么是JVM JVM 全称是 Java Virtual Machine,中文译名 Java虚拟机。 JVM 本质上是一个运行在计算机上的程序,他的职责是运行Java字节码文件。 Java虚